What is recorded here

Situated at the tip of a S-N spur. A circular embanked enclosure is depicted on the 1834 edition of the OS 6-inch map where it is described as a ‘Fort’, and is it depicted as a hachured feature on the 1907 edition. It is still extant and is most clearly visible as a circular grass-covered area (diam. c. 35m N-S; c. 30m E-W) on Google Earth (08/04/2015; 29/09/2015; 07/02/2019) defined by a small earthen bank that is most visible SW-W-NE.
